About The Position

This role is a skilled machinist position responsible for precision engine rebuilding, component reconditioning, and machine shop operations in support of automotive repair services. The Automotive Machinist performs hands-on work on engine blocks, cylinder heads, crankshafts, flywheels, brake rotors/drums, and related components using specialized machine shop equipment. Must be capable of working independently with high accuracy and efficiency. This is a physically demanding role requiring prolonged standing, bending, and lifting of heavy engine components throughout the day. Fine motor control, mechanical aptitude, and attention to tolerance specifications are essential. To provide high-quality machining and reconditioning services. The Automotive Machinist ensures that engine and drivetrain components meet manufacturer specifications prior to installation, reducing warranty comebacks and extending the life of customer vehicles.

Requirements

  • Demonstrated ability to operate engine lathes, boring bars, valve seat and guide machines, surface grinders, honing machines, and brake lathes.
  • Proficiency in reading and interpreting micrometer, dial indicator, and bore gauge measurements to manufacturer tolerance specifications.
  • Must own or be willing to acquire personal precision measuring tools required for the role.
  • Ability to interpret and apply OEM service data and machining specifications from reference systems such as All Data or equivalent.

Responsibilities

  • Perform cylinder boring, honing, decking, valve seat grinding, and related engine block and head reconditioning services.
  • Resurface brake rotors and drums to manufacturer specifications using brake lathe equipment.
  • Inspect and measure all components prior to machining to determine serviceability and required machining operations.
  • Maintain precise records of machining work performed including measurements before and after operations.
  • Keep machine shop equipment properly calibrated, maintained, and cleaned after each use.
